Senior Science Technician at East London Science School - London, N/A, UK
Principal
Contact David Perks
Head of Year and Head of Computer Science
Contact Dale Perkins
Head Of Chemistry
Contact Maximilien Louveaux
Exam Invgilator / COVID Administrator
Contact Audra Norris
Head of French
Contact Paule-Julia Ahoune
English Teacher
Contact Michael Knight
Reception Administration
Contact Lauren Ball